What’s the big deal about harmonic balancer bolts? As the revs of your high-performance engine rise, your crankshaft starts to flex. The harmonic balancer press fit to the end absorbs those vibrations, protecting your main bearings and crankshaft bearings while keeping your engine running smoothly. Many stock harmonic balancer bolts are torque-to-yield (TTY) bolts, which means they shouldn’t be reused. So, whether you’re replacing a stock balancer, or upgrading to a durable race-ready model, you should get new hardware for it as well. Eliminate fastener problems with Stage 8's complete line of locking bolt kits. They provide a simple, yet effective method to insure that your fasteners do not loosen unexpectedly. Each fastener uses a mechanical clip to lock it in place, and preventing it from backing out. The clip acts like leaving a small wrench on the bolt head, as the clip prevents the fastener from turning. Easier to use than safety wire, and cleaner than chemical thread lockers, it remains locked in place until manually disassembled.
